Meaning, origin, history

Eberardo is a distinctive and unique name of Germanic origin. It is derived from the Old German elements "Eber" meaning "wild boar" and "hard" which means "strong, brave". Therefore, Eberardo can be interpreted as "as strong as a wild boar". The name Eberardo has a rich history dating back to the Middle Ages in Europe. It was traditionally given to boys born into noble families or those with a desire for power and prestige. Over time, it has become less common but remains a popular choice among parents looking for a unique and meaningful name for their child. Despite its historical association with nobility, Eberardo is not limited to any particular social class or culture. Today, it can be found in various countries around the world, including Spain, Italy, Portugal, and even Brazil, where it has been adopted by families seeking to give their children a unique and memorable name. In terms of popularity, Eberardo is considered quite rare. According to data from the Social Security Administration in the United States, only 16 boys were named Eberardo between 2000 and 2019. This rarity can be appealing to parents who wish for their child's name to stand out and have a special significance.
